What is a certificate of compliance with technical regulations?

Definition

Certificate of compliance with technical regulations is an official document confirming that the products meet the requirements of technical regulations established by the legislation of the country. This certificate is issued by accredited certification bodies on the basis of tests and inspections.

The legislative framework

Each country has its own system of technical regulations and standards governing the process of product certification. In the Russian Federation, for example, the requirements for product certification are determined by the Federal Law "On Technical Regulation" and the relevant technical regulations.

Procedure for obtaining a certificate of conformity with technical regulations

Stages of certification

1. Preparation of documents: The applicant must provide the necessary documents, including the application for certification, technical documentation for products and test reports.

2. Testing: Products undergo laboratory tests for compliance with the requirements of technical regulations.

3. Conformity assessment: Based on the test results, the accredited certification body makes a decision on issuing or refusing to issue a certificate.

4. Issuance of certificate: In case of a positive decision, the applicant is issued a certificate of compliance with the technical regulations, confirming the conformity of products with the established requirements.

Documents required

1. Application for certification: An official statement from the manufacturer or importer.

2. Technical documentation: Product description, drawings, schemes, technical specifications and other documents characterizing the products.

3. Test reports: Documents confirming the results of laboratory studies and tests.

4. Quality certificates: Documents confirming compliance of products with international standards (if any).
